Properties of Electric Field Lines Explaining Attraction

Description:
The electric field lines behave like a stretched string, which is always under tension and tries to reduce its length to come back to its original form.
For example. If there are two dissimilar charges and if their electric field line tries to reduce its length by pulling each other towards itself (as shown in figure) it means charges are exerting the force of attraction on each other. So in case of two dissimilar charges, they experience force of attraction.
